本文目录导读:
在关系数据库中,表与表之间的联系是构建高效数据模型的核心,这种联系不仅保证了数据的完整性和一致性,还提高了数据查询和处理的速度,本文将深入解析关系数据库中表与表之间的联系,探讨其重要性以及如何实现有效的表间关联。
表与表之间的联系的重要性
1、数据完整性和一致性:通过表与表之间的联系,可以确保数据的完整性和一致性,在订单和商品表中建立联系,可以保证每个订单都对应一个有效的商品。
图片来源于网络,如有侵权联系删除
2、提高查询效率:通过表与表之间的联系,可以简化查询语句,提高查询效率,在员工和部门表中建立联系,可以直接查询某个部门下的所有员工。
3、降低数据冗余:通过表与表之间的联系,可以避免数据冗余,减少存储空间,在订单和客户表中建立联系,可以避免重复存储客户信息。
4、便于数据维护:通过表与表之间的联系,可以简化数据维护工作,在修改某个部门信息时,只需在部门表中修改一次,即可同步更新所有相关联的员工信息。
表与表之间的联系类型
1、一对一联系:表示一个表中的每条记录只与另一个表中的一条记录相关联,员工和工资表之间存在一对一联系。
图片来源于网络,如有侵权联系删除
2、一对多联系:表示一个表中的每条记录可以与另一个表中的多条记录相关联,部门和员工表之间存在一对多联系。
3、多对多联系:表示两个表中的每条记录可以与另一个表中的多条记录相关联,学生和课程表之间存在多对多联系。
实现表与表之间的联系
1、外键约束:通过外键约束,可以确保表与表之间的联系,在创建表时,可以为外键设置参照完整性约束,确保数据的正确性。
2、连接查询:通过连接查询,可以查询表与表之间的关联数据,使用SQL语句查询某个部门下的所有员工信息。
图片来源于网络,如有侵权联系删除
3、视图:通过创建视图,可以将多个表关联起来,简化查询操作,创建一个视图,将部门和员工信息关联起来,便于查询。
4、存储过程:通过存储过程,可以封装表与表之间的复杂关联操作,提高数据处理的效率。
在关系数据库中,表与表之间的联系是构建高效数据模型的关键,通过合理地设计表与表之间的联系,可以确保数据的完整性和一致性,提高查询效率,降低数据冗余,便于数据维护,在实际应用中,应根据具体需求选择合适的联系类型和实现方法,以提高数据库的性能和可维护性。
标签: #在关系数据库中表与表之间的联系是通过
评论列表